Obituary

William Thomas “TMac” McDaniel, III, 73, of Lexington, passed away peacefully on September 9, 2023. He was born to parents Bill and Mary McDaniel, on July 28, 1950 in Augusta, Georgia.

TMac was a graduate of Batesburg-Leesville High School and Clemson University. He was the owner of TMac’s Fine Shoes on Main Street and then enjoyed time working at Gentlemen’s Closet store in Five Points.

TMac is survived by his daughter, Ashleigh Near (Jesse), his son, Trey McDaniel (Jessi), and his, brother Richard McDaniel (Faye) of Batesburg-Leesville as well as his four grandchildren, Caroline, Daniel, Will and Emersyn.

TMac was predeceased by parents Bill and Mary McDaniel.

The family welcomes you to a visitation that will be held on Saturday, September 16, 2023, from 10am-12pm at Barr-Price Funeral Home in Lexington. Please come celebrate and share memories dressed in your game day gear! The family will have a private ceremony at a later date.
